Chapter 11: Calculation of Time, from the Atom

The material manifestation's ultimate particle - not indivisible and not formed into the body is called atom. It always exists as invisible identity even after dissolutions of all forms. The material body is but a combination of such atoms but misunderstood by common man. Atoms are the ultimate state of the manifest universe. When they stay in their own forms without forming differnt bodies they are called the ultimate oneness.They form the complete manifestation on their own.

One can estimate time by measuring the movement of the atomic combination of bodies. Time is the potency of the Lord, who controls all physical movement although He is not visible in the physical world. Atomic time is measured according to its covering a particular atomic space. Atomic time is measured according to its covering a particular atomic space. The division of gross time is calculated as follows - 2 atoms make a double atom and 3 double atoms make a hexatom. This hexatom is visible in the sunshine which enters through the holes of a window screen. One can clearly see that the hexatom goes up towards the sky. This hexatom is called a trasarenu. 3 trasarenus make a truti and 100 trutis make a vedha. 3 vedhas make a lava. 3 lavas equal to one nimesa (second) and 3 nimesas make 1 ksana, 5 ksnas make 1 kastha and 15 kasthas make 1 laghu (2 minutes). 15 laghus make one nadika a.k.a danda. 2 dandas make 1 muhurta, 6/7 dandas make 1/4 day or night. 

Measuring pot for 1 nadika or danda can be done by taking a 4 oz pot of copper, boring a hole with a gold probe 4 fingers long and then placing the pot in water and time before the water overflows the pot is a danda. 

There are 4 praharas aka yamas (3 hours) in the day and 4 at night. 15 days make a fortnight (paksah) and 2 fortnights white and black in a month. The aggregate of 2 fortnights in 1 month and the period of 1 day and night for the pita planets. 2 months make a season and 6 months comprise movement of the sun from south to north. 2 solar movements make one day and night of the demigods and that combination is one complete year for a human being who lives for 100 years.

Stars, planets, luminaries, atoms all over the universe are rotating in their respective orbits under the Lord represented by eternal kala. 5 different names for orbits of the sun, moon, stars and luminaries in the firmament and each have their own samvatsara (scheduled orbital time). 

One truṭi - 8/13,500 second
One vedha - 8/135 second
One lava - 8/45 second
One nimeṣa - 8/15 second
One kṣaṇa - 8/5 second
One kāṣṭhā - 8 seconds
One laghu - 2 minutes
One daṇḍa - 30 minutes
One prahara - 3 hours
One day - 12 hours
One night - 12 hours
One pakṣa - 15 days

Then Maitreya said - 4 millenniums are called - satya, treta, dvapara and kali . The aggregate number of years of all of these combined is equal to 12,000 years (yuga sandhyas) of the demigods (1 year of demigod = 360 years of human kind = 4.32 million years).  Satya = 4800 years of demigods, Dvapara = 2400, kali = 1200 of demigods.  Transitional periods before and after each millennium which is a few 100 years are called yuga sandhyas. In those periods all kinds of religious activities are performed. Satya yuga mankind properly and completely maintained the principles of religion but it kept getting decreased by one part of irreligion. so in satya it was 4 parts of religion and now it's 1 part religion and 3 parts irreligion.

outside the 3 planetary systems (svarga, martya and patala), 4 yugas * 1000 = 1 day of Brahma and similar is 1 night of Brahma when he sleeps - then the 3 planetary systems below brahmaloka are submerged under water of devastation and he dreams of Garbodaksayi visnu and takes instructions for rehabilitation of the devastated areas of space. After the end of Brahmā's night, the creation of the three worlds begins again in the daytime of Brahmā, and they continue to exist through the life durations of fourteen consecutive Manus, or fathers of mankind.

Each and every Manu enjoys life a little more than 71 sets of 4 millenniums. The three planetary systems revolve and the inhabitants including the lower animals, human beings, demigos and pitas appear and disapper in terms of frutive activities. With every change of Manu, the Supreme personality of Godhead appears by manifesting his internal potency in different incarnations. At the end of Brahma's day, under the insignificant portion of the mode of darkness, the powerful manifestation of the universe merges in the darkness of night. By the influence of eternal time, the living entities remain merged in the dissolution and everything is silent.And the 3 worlds are out of sight and the sun and moon are without glare (the other planetary systems still have the glare of sun and moon). The devastation takes place due to the fire emanating from the mouth of Sankarsana and great sages like Bhrgu and other inhabitants of Maharloka transport themselves to Janaloka - distressed by the warmth of the blazing sun below (3 worlds). There are seas, hurricane winds and devastation. The Supreme Lord, the Personality of Godhead, lies down in the water on the seat of Ananta, with His eyes closed, and the inhabitants of the Janaloka planets offer their glorious prayers unto the Lord with folded hands. The 100 years of Brahma are divided into 2 parts. first half was brahma kalpa where he appeared and the vedas were also born then. The millennium following brahma kalp is called padma kalpa (pitr kalpa) - that's where the universal lotus flower grew out of the naval of Lord. First millenium in second part of Brahma's life is called varaha (lord apperas as boar).
